SASAWASHI fabric is made by blending Kumazasa fibres; grown in the cool highlands of Japan, with Washi paper. Washi is strong, durable and water-resistant used in traditional Shoji slidding doors keeping homes cool in summer and warm in winter. A sheet of these blended fibres is then slit into long strings of yarn, twisted together to machine weave or knit SASAWASHI yarn and fabric.
